Dave Seaton
Chairman
Dave has had a successful commercial career spanning over 43 years holding senior executive positions within the Oil & Gas service industry (Schlumberger), Security industry (ArmorGroup International) and latterly within both the Support Services sector and M & A consultancy. Over the course of his ten years with ArmorGroup he oversaw it growing from an £100m turnover business operating in less than ten countries to a £300m turnover business operating in 38 countries when it was sold in early 2008. He is known for both his commercial and man management skills while having a comprehensive appreciation for operational issues and their challenges. The last twenty years has seen him active in the Support Service industry within the UK including leading an MBO of Resource Group a £ 120m t/o security and cleaning business, forming a start-up FM business in Scotland and in 2019 acquiring GLEN Group a then £15m t/o business based in Bristol. The latter has grown to be a £ 40m T/o Group following two bolt-on acquisitions and significant organic growth. Dave currently splits his time between Chairing and sitting on the board of several businesses including Ameroc ERW, UB Infrastructure, Glen Group, Ambrey Baker, Panacea Brokers – an insurance brokerage and leading the corporate finance function of Morphose Capital Partners – an FCA accredited M & A consultancy. Dave also Chairs Horseback UK a charity supporting disabled military personnel and has done since it was formed 17 years ago. Over the course of his career Dave has led on over 45 acquisitions and disposals both for companies he has managed and others he has been appointed to advise either as a director of Morphose Capital Partners or as a freelance consultant.

Alan North
Group Compliance Director
Alan brings a wealth of knowledge and experience to the world of compliance. He joined Glen Group following a career spanning 25 years in the British Army, 20 years with Compass Group, and 11 years as a senior trainer and auditor for a leading Certification Body. He is a qualified ISO Lead Auditor in ISO 9001, ISO 14001, ISO 45001, and ISO 50001, as well as a qualified teacher and trainer in these disciplines. More than 30 years of his career have been spent in and around the cleaning industry. While with Compass Group, Alan developed the initial Quality Management System for its Catering and Cleaning operations and helped achieve ISO certification across the entire UK portfolio — a major undertaking, with the initial certification audit lasting more than 100 days. At Glen Group, Alan has helped the business achieve certification to all four ISO standards, including ISO 50001:2018, making Glen one of the relatively few cleaning companies to achieve this energy management standard. He has also supported Glen in achieving Constructionline Gold, Safe Contractor, and numerous other certifications and accreditations. Fully qualified in Health & Safety, Environmental Management and Quality, Alan oversees compliance alongside Kim Stevens and is passionate about maintaining high standards and keeping Glen on the right path. Away from work, Alan is a keen gardener and enjoys watching sport, particularly golf and football. Fun fact: In 1994, while serving as a senior Warrant Officer (SSM), Alan accompanied the British Army Culinary Team to the Culinary Olympics in Frankfurt. The team won several gold medals and presented one to Alan in recognition of his advice and support.
